Pros

First of all, all employees love the products! Ancestry is diligently seeking to improve the customer experience, the work culture, and our product offerings. Overall, my time at Ancestry was positive, and with the new CEO and focus on core values, there have been lots of great changes. Glassdoor feedback seems to have improved from 3.1 to 3.4 in the last 6 months, which is indicative of the forward momentum and sentiment by employees and former employees.

Cons

Like any mid to large organization moving fast, there are sometimes issues alignment of the whole organization working towards one purpose. Ancestry is working hard to address this with regular town halls with executive management and frank communications regarding issues.

Pros

The work-life balance is pretty good. I have never had issues taking time off when I needed to. The pay and benefits are on par with other, similar jobs in the area. There are many long-time employees at the company.

Cons

The company is product-led, so leadership is more concerned with shipping new features than they are with making sure what they have already shipped works well. Restricted stock unit grants always come with a one year vesting cliff, whether an employee has worked at the company for two years or twenty years. They do not appear to trust that long-time employees will continue to stay at the company, even though they have many long-time employees.
